1975 Topps Johnny Bench #260 PSA Gem Mint 10. Johnny Bench, a key figure for the Cincinnati Reds, is widely regarded as one of the greatest catchers in baseball history. Over his 17-season career, he earned 14 All-Star selections and 10 Gold Glove Awards, showcasing his exceptional skill both offensively and defensively. Bench was instrumental in the Reds' success during the 1970s, helping them win two World Series titles. Inducted into the Baseball Hall of Fame in 1989, his legacy endures as a benchmark for excellence at the catcher position. Card #260 showcases Bench during his prime, reflecting his outstanding skills and contributions to the game. Graded PSA Gem Mint 10. With more than 3,600 PSA submissions, this is one of just thirteen examples graded GEM MINT!
